1 Samuel 2:17-24 The Scriptures 1998 (ISR98)

17. And the sin of the young men was very great before יהוה, for the men despised the offering of יהוה.

18. But Shemu’ĕl was attending before יהוה – a youth, wearing a linen shoulder garment.

19. And his mother would make him a little robe, and bring it to him year by year when she came up with her husband to offer the yearly slaughtering.

20. And Ěli blessed Elqanah and his wife, and said, “יהוה give you offspring from this woman for the one she prayed for and gave to יהוה.” Then they would go to their own home.

21. And יהוה visited Ḥannah, so that she conceived and bore three sons and two daughters, while the young Shemu’ĕl grew before יהוה.

22. And Ěli was very old, and had heard all that his sons were doing to all Yisra’ĕl, and how they lay with the women who were assembling at the door of the Tent of Meeting.

23. And he said to them, “Why do you do deeds like these? For I hear of your evil deeds from all the people.

24. “No, my sons! For it is not a good report that I hear: making the people of יהוה transgress.
